目的对MPT63、Ag85A、RV2031c和融合蛋白CFP10-ESAT6四种结核分枝杆菌抗原进行诊断效能评价,优选出最佳的抗原组合,分析其应用价值。方法基于酶联免疫吸附试验,分别用MPT63、Ag85A、RV2031c和融合蛋白CFP10-ESAT6四种重组结核抗原,对199份血清(含94份结核病患者血清和105份健康者血清)进行检测。结合受试者工作特征曲线法计算不同抗原的最佳临界值(cut-off value)并以此确立各抗原组合的灵敏度、特异度、阳性预测值、阴性预测值和诊断效率,对它们的诊断效能和应用价值进行综合评价。结果 11种组合中Rv2031c与CFP10-ESAT6的组合诊断效能最好,灵敏度为63.8%,特异度为82.9%,阳性预测值为76.9%,阴性预测值为71.9%,诊断效率为73.9%。其余组合的灵敏度的范围30.9%~66%,特异度范围76.2%~90.5%。结论 Rv2031c和CFP10-ESAT6组合后的诊断效能最佳,有一定的临床应用价值。
Objective To assess the performance of four recombination Mycobacterium tuberculosis protein antigens (MPT63, Ag85A, RV2031c and fusion protein CFP10 - ESAT6) in the serological diagnosis of tuberculosis, to select the optimal combina- tion of the antigens and to analyze their application values. Methods Based on enzyme- linked immunosorbent assay (ELISA), 199 serum samples (94 from TB patients and 105 from healthy individuals) were tested by means of the four recombi- nation antigens respectively. Sensitivity, specificity, positive predictive value, negative predictive value and diagnostic efficiency were calculated after getting the cut- off value with the results of ELISA and receiver operating characteristic (RC)C) curve anal- ysis. Comprehensive diagnosis performance and application values of these antigens and different combinations were evaluated. Results Among the eleven kinds of combinations, the combination of Rv2031c and CFP10 - ESAT6 had the best diagnostic ef- ficiency, and its sensitivky, specificity, positive predictive value, negative predictive value and diagnostic efficiency were 63.8 %, 82.9%, 76.9%, 71.9% and 73.9%, respectively. The sensitivity and specificity of the other combinations ranged from 30.9 % to 66 % and from 76.2 % to 90.5 %, respectively. Conclusions The combination of antigens Rv203 lc and CFP10 - ESAT6 has very good performance in TB diagnosis and possesses a certain application value in clinical practice.
